Nearly 2,400 people applaud Éric Zemmour in Charvieu-Chavagneux in Isère

They came to see a man he often sees on television, a man “who will straighten France” or a man whose “politics are getting more and more interesting.” Nearly 2,400 people followed Eric Zemmour’s speech cFriday evening in the David Douille gymnasium in Charvieu-Chavagneux in Isère

The former journalist goes where invites him he said, and the mayor of the commune Gérard Dézempte took charge of doing it. An approach strongly criticized by the left and environmentalists with a press release in the days preceding the visit of Eric Zemmour, but the elected Republicans assumes it: if the polemicist is a candidate, he will most certainly vote for him.

A discourse on the state and its institutions

For an hour, Éric Zemmour speaks on the theme of the state and its institutions, gangrened according to him by ideologies. “We must no longer hand over our state and our civil servants, and our teachers, and our children, to minorities who undertake against stumbling block to teach them what to think, say, feel” he exclaims. He talks about feminist, anti-racist, LGBT lobbies and leftist ideologies.

The public approves, sometimes with a loud cry of approval sometimes long applauses. With this meeting in “Lyon region”, not once has he mentioned Isère, Éric Zemmour has found “a warm audience” and convinced. During the few exchanges that followed the speech, almost all the speakers greeted “courage” of this man who is already the candidate of many members of the public, even before running for the presidential election.
